Ziqi Ren is a scholar working on Biomedical Engineering, Electrical and Electronic Engineering and Polymers and Plastics. According to data from OpenAlex, Ziqi Ren has authored 16 papers receiving a total of 841 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Biomedical Engineering, 8 papers in Electrical and Electronic Engineering and 6 papers in Polymers and Plastics. Recurrent topics in Ziqi Ren’s work include Advanced Sensor and Energy Harvesting Materials (15 papers), Conducting polymers and applications (6 papers) and Gas Sensing Nanomaterials and Sensors (5 papers). Ziqi Ren is often cited by papers focused on Advanced Sensor and Energy Harvesting Materials (15 papers), Conducting polymers and applications (6 papers) and Gas Sensing Nanomaterials and Sensors (5 papers). Ziqi Ren collaborates with scholars based in China. Ziqi Ren's co-authors include Yihua Gao, Nishuang Liu, Qixiang Zhang, Dandan Lei, Luoxin Wang, Tuoyi Su, Jun Su, Zhi Zhang, Wenzhong Lü and Jianyu Yin and has published in prestigious journals such as Advanced Materials, ACS Nano and Advanced Functional Materials.
